1992 Buick Roadmaster vs. 2006 Lancia Thesis

To start off, 2006 Lancia Thesis is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Buick Roadmaster.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Buick Roadmaster would be higher. At 5,000 cc (8 cylinders), 1992 Buick Roadmaster is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Lancia Thesis (182 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 14 more horse power than 1992 Buick Roadmaster. (168 HP @ 4200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Lancia Thesis should accelerate faster than 1992 Buick Roadmaster.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1992 Buick Roadmaster weights approximately 305 kg more than 2006 Lancia Thesis.

Because 1992 Buick Roadmaster is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1992 Buick Roadmaster.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Lancia Thesis,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Buick Roadmaster (346 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 38 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Lancia Thesis. (308 Nm @ 2200 RPM). This means 1992 Buick Roadmaster will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Lancia Thesis. 1992 Buick Roadmaster has automatic transmission and 2006 Lancia Thesis has manual transmission. 2006 Lancia Thesis will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1992 Buick Roadmaster will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1992 Buick Roadmaster 2006 Lancia Thesis
Make Buick Lancia
Model Roadmaster Thesis
Year Released 1992 2006
Body Type Station Wagon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5000 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 5 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 168 HP 182 HP
Engine RPM 4200 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 346 Nm 308 Nm
Torque RPM 2400 RPM 2200 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 2000 kg 1695 kg
Vehicle Length 5540 mm 4890 mm
Vehicle Width 2040 mm 1840 mm
Vehicle Height 1540 mm 1470 mm
Wheelbase Size 2950 mm 2810 mm
